Adam Lambert Stops Live Show To Ask Girl To Get Off The Phone

February 16, 2010



Adam Lambert was performing a live show last night at the P.C. Richard & Son Theater for iheartradio STRIPPED in NYC when there was a fan in the front row chatting on her cell phone and Adam stopped the song and called her out.

“Can you get off your phone? You’re yelling into it…Sorry we’re gonna start over, sorry guys. Really??!  Domino’s we deliver, You’re not watching TV honey it’s a live show.”
